Abstract
The discovery of radial and non-radial global oscillations of the Sun through various types of detector systems has opened the field of solar seismology. Of particular importance for studies of the deep interior of stars are the detection and analysis of low harmonic order pulsations such as the low order p-modes recently found on the Sun1,2 by line shift measurements. These pulsations have now also been detected in the solar brightness fluctuations. Through the reflected light of Uranus and Neptune the Sun was observed as though it were a distant star. The positive results suggest that broad-band photometry has the greatest potential for developing seismometry of main sequence stars.
